“Flashover” Review: Chinese Action-Packed Thriller Arouses Respect For Firefighters

Fasten your seatbelts and buckle in, because this is way more than your average disaster movie. You’re in for a ride for this action-packed thriller.

Directed by Oxide Pang (彭顺), Flashover (惊天救援) tells the story of a group of firefighters fighting for the lives of others and themselves amidst a large-scale disaster. Based on true events that happened in China, the movie stars Du Jiang (杜江), Wang Qianyuan (王千源), Tong Liya (佟丽娅), Han Xue (韩雪) and many other talented casts.

Set in Guangchen, China, an earthquake triggers two massive explosions at a chemical plant. These two massive explosions wipes out the entire industrial zone, causing collapses, casualties and a fire in a neighboring school. Upon hearing about the disaster, Captain Zhao and his team immediately leave to the scene to assist with rescuing and the fire in order to prevent another burst nearing the effect of a nuclear explosion.

Among the chaos and fallen debris, the front-line firefighters have to scale through difficult surfaces and heights while using their quick wits in order to rescue the wounded and combat the blaze. However, when you think things cannot get any worse – it does.

Unlike other disaster films, this film captures the whole process of the life of a firefighter when duty calls. From the departure, to gearing up, rescuing, up until tackling the raging fires, the film captures them all perfectly.

Closely displaying the intimate relationship the firefighters have throughout the different hardships they face with each other, the film depicts ‘friendship’ surrounding the chaos. “Flashover” shows how seriously these firefighters take their jobs. The bravery and strength of being able to put everyone else above themselves is truly respectable. When push comes to shove, they must also think on their feet and act swiftly.

The film has decent pacing, with climaxes that truly keep you at the edge of your seats the whole movie. What will happen next? How would they save this citizen this time? Will they make it out safely? Well, those questions will answer itself once you watch the movie.

There are definitely scenes here that will stir up different emotions, and you can’t help but have deep respect for the firefighters in real life. Although the film may have parts that are exaggerated in order to attract audiences, it still focuses on the core values of a firefighter.
